"We really wanted to keep him, but the reason and sense of reality led us to take a different decision," explained the president an interview for the German paper 'Bild'.
Fredi Bobic highlighted the opportunity Jovic had been presented with: "You have the possibility to join one of the best European clubs and win there the most important titles which exist, without mentioning the difference in salary. It's a great opportunity for him."
Jovic went to the Santiago Bernabeu for 60 million euros plus bonuses. An amount which is much more than the 16 that Eintracht Frankfurt paid Benfica beforehand.
The Bosnian, one of the strikers with the brightest future in Europe, was the top scorer for his team last season and is confident of making the step up in his career.
